Vegan Shepherd's Pie

Vegan Shepherd's Pie is made with lentils, mushrooms and a creamy vegan mashed potato topping - hearty vegan main ready in an hour!

What you Need

Saute vegetables


Add olive oil in a heated pot, followed by the vegetables, and Italian seasoning. Cook, until vegetables are softened.

Add tomato puree


Add wine, and reduce. Add tomato puree, Worcestershire sauce, and balsamic vinegar.

Add tomatoes


Cook for another minute. Add chopped mushrooms, red lentils, diced tomatoes, and vegetable broth.

Cook and simmer


Bring to a boil, then reduce the heat to low. Simmer for 20 minutes.

Prepare for baking


Transfer the filling to a baking dish and top with dollop spoonfuls of mashed potato, spread with a silicone spatula.



Bake for 20 minutes. Remove from the oven and let it sit for 5 minutes before carving. Serve with peas, if desired.

- Make sure to cool the mashed potatoes. - Bake until the top is golden brown. - Get creative with garnishes.

Expert Tips

Ready to make this Vegan Shepherd's Pie?